Faculty members in the Department of Radiology contribute to the education of medical students and maintain a four-year residency program for diagnostic radiology.

The Larner College of Medicine requires three study levels for the Doctor of Medicine degree, with a curriculum shaped by student and faculty feedback to train exceptional practitioners. Fourth-year students can take a one-month radiology elective, applying their anatomy and disease knowledge to imaging for patient care. They can choose from ten subspecialties, including interventional radiology, and have the option to arrange a research elective. The program includes clinical work and daily didactic conferences.
